Small, squat, and vaguely UFO-shaped, patty pan squash may have left you scratching your head in the produce section. But this squash, available year-round in well-stocked grocery stores but in season during the summer, is a delicious addition to your kitchen. Patty pan squash has a mild flavor, similar to yellow squash or zucchini, and is available in hues of yellow and green.

Instructions. Preheat the oven to 425°F. Wash patty pan squash and trim the top and bottom. Cut into 1" bite sized pieces. Toss with olive oil, garlic and salt & pepper to taste. Roast on a baking sheet for 12-15 minutes or just until tender-crisp. Broil 1 minute if desired. While squash is roasting, finely chop herbs.
